Andhra Pradesh Public Service Commission (APPSC) proposed a significant change on Monday Examination process For government job recruitment in various departments, reported AyraNews24x7.
According to the report, the APPSC is only planning to conduct the preliminary examination, when the number of applications received exceeds 200 times.
The report states that currently, both prelims and men’s exams Take Despite the number of vacancies, if the number of applications cross 25,000, keep it.
However, considering it an unnecessary expenditure and waste of time, Appsc is now doing the Mulling A new filtering systemIf this proposal is accepted, many Andhra Pradesh Public Service Commission recruitment can be conducted with just one examination instead of two.
Meanwhile, by a report Careers360 It has been said that the Andhra Pradesh government has accepted the proposal and has implemented it for recently announced recruitment and defeated the officer in Andhra Pradesh Forest Subordinate Service.
What can change?
If a notification is issued for 100 posts, the Andhra Pradesh Public Service Commission will conduct only one initial (Prelims) examination on receiving more than 20,000 applications. Otherwise, AppSC may directly conduct single-phase recruitment process or main examination.
